present progressiveof comply (3rd person singular).present progressive
Used to describe an ongoing action or state that is currently taking place in the immediate present.
complyverb (used without object)to act or be in accordance with wishes, requests, demands, requirements, conditions, etc.; agree (sometimes followed bywith ).
